Increased Sweating
A physiological condition where the body sweats more than usual, typically in response to heat, physical exertion, or stress.
Brown Adipose Tissue
A type of fat tissue in mammals that generates heat by burning calories, significantly contributing to thermoregulation.
Mitochondria
Organelles found in most eukaryotic cells, acting as the site of cellular respiration and energy production through the creation of ATP.
Skeletal Muscle
A type of striated muscle tissue which is attached to bones and is involved in the control of voluntary movements of the body.
